Issue
I'm trying to restore my iPhone 3G. I've connected it to my PC, iTunes detected it and I've launched the restauration process. After a few minutes, the download stops and iTunes displats the following error message:
"error 3259 "
Solution
A simple solution that has been tested, is to disable the antivirus of your PC, during this process. It seems to be a limit, either in time or volume of data that can be downloaded. Thus, downloading via iTunes (very heavy) systematically crashes. By disabling the antivirus, you can download without problems.
